How we determine pricing
Deck Size
The size of your deck significantly influences its cost. Larger decks are more expensive due to the increased materials required and the higher fees for design and construction services.
Deck Style and Complexity
When planning your deck consider its purpose, budget, available space, and the materials you want to use, such as pressure-treated wood, composite materials, cedar, PVC, or hardwood. Think about additional features that you’ll want like built-in seating, railings, and lighting. There are many factors to consider when designing your deck, and remember that each extra feature you add can increase the cost.
Deck Materials Being Used
When deciding on deck materials, consider factors like durability, maintenance, aesthetics, cost, environmental impact, slip resistance, and safety. Popular options include pressure-treated wood, cedar, composite materials, PVC, and hardwood. Generally, composite and hardwood materials tend to be more expensive, while pressure-treated wood is the most cost-effective but requires more maintenance. Choose the material that best fits your needs, budget, and lifestyle.
Deck rails
Popular materials include wood, composite, aluminum steel, and scenic glass. Generally, wood is the most cost-effective but requires regular maintenance, while composite and metal railings are more durable and low-maintenance. Glass and cable railings are more expensive but offer modern aesthetics and unobstructed views.
Deck Pricing
Category | Description | Prices Starting at | Price Type |
---|---|---|---|
Decking | Sienna Brown Pressure Treated Wood | $25.00 | Per square foot |
Decking | Cedar | $35.00 | Per square foot |
Decking | Composite
| $40.00 | Per square foot |
Decking | PVC | $50.00 | Per square foot |
Railing | Wood with Aluminum Balusters | $65.00 | Per linear foot |
Railing | Aluminum Picket Rail | $100.00 | Per linear foot |
Railing | Aluminum Rail With Glass Panels | $140.00 | Per linear foot |
Railing | Scenic glass rail (frameless) | $190.00 | Per linear foot |
